Biomass Estimation Using Statistical And Neural Network Analysis Of Aster Data, Vijay O. Lulla
Biomass Estimation Using Statistical And Neural Network Analysis Of Aster Data, Vijay O. Lulla
All-Inclusive List of Electronic Theses and Dissertations
This study assessed the performance of different biomass estimation methods using Advanced Spaceborne Thermal Emission and Reflection Radiometer (ASTER) lll data in a temperate forest. Multiple linear regression statistics of spectral band data and derived indices with biomass values were compared with advanced neural network models created with spectral band data and indices to model biomass values. Biomass for the study area was estimated using both of these methods and the results were discussed. The data were analyzed using multivariate statistical analysis. Correlation analysis and regression analysis were employed to understand the relationship of biomass to the spectral data and …

Fire-Induced Albedo Change And Its Radative Forcing At The Surface In Northern Austrailia, Y. Jin, David P. Roy
Fire-Induced Albedo Change And Its Radative Forcing At The Surface In Northern Austrailia, Y. Jin, David P. Roy
GSCE Faculty Publications
This paper investigates the impact of fire on surface albedo and the associated radiative forcing over 56% of continental Australia encompassing the fire-prone northern tropical savanna. Fire-affected areas and albedos are derived for the 2003 fire season using daily Moderate Resolution Imaging Spectroradiometer (MODIS) surface reflectance data. Near-infrared and total shortwave albedos are observed to generally decrease after fire occurrence. Regionally, the total shortwave albedo drops by an average of 0.024, with increasing reductions as the dry season progresses and larger reductions in grasslands than woody savannas. These fire-induced albedo changes exert a positive forcing at the surface that increases …
Hyperspectral Simulation And Recovery Of Submerged Targets In Turbid Waters, Charles R. Bostater
Hyperspectral Simulation And Recovery Of Submerged Targets In Turbid Waters, Charles R. Bostater
Ocean Engineering and Marine Sciences Faculty Publications
Modeled hyperspectral reflectance signatures just above the water surface are obtained from radiative transfer models to create synthetic images of targets below the water surface. Images are displayed as 24 bit RGB images of the water surface using selected channels. Example model outputs are presented in this paper for a hyperspectral Monte Carlo and a hyperspectral layered analytical iterative model of radiative transport within turbid shallow water types. Images at the selected wavelengths or channels centered at 490, 530 and 680 nm suggests the two models provide quite similar results when displayed as RGB images. The techniques are demonstrated to …

Modeling And Simulation Of Commercial Satellite Imagery Processes, David A. Shultz
Modeling And Simulation Of Commercial Satellite Imagery Processes, David A. Shultz
Theses and Dissertations
The purpose of this research was to develop a general, statistical model of order-to-delivery times for commercial satellite imagery. The research looked at the current four satellite providers with 3-meter or better imagers in the context of a generalized model of commercial imaging satellite operations. Existing methods use orbit analysis tools to determine the imaging time of a specified target based on defined satellite position and times, but can only develop shortest and longest times to an imaging opportunity. To address the general question of the time it takes to deliver an image for non-specific targets, this research develops a …

Geospatial Analysis Of Gravel Bar Deposition And Channel Migration Within The Ozark National Scenic Riverways, Missouri (1955-2003), Derek J. Martin
Geospatial Analysis Of Gravel Bar Deposition And Channel Migration Within The Ozark National Scenic Riverways, Missouri (1955-2003), Derek J. Martin
Graduate Theses/Dissertations
Historical land clearing is believed to be responsible for present-day channel instability in main stem reaches in the Ozark National Scenic Riverways (ONSR) in south-central Missouri. The nature of instability is related to the delivery of excess amounts of gravel sediment to stream channels and higher rates of lateral bank erosion. These conditions are of concern to resource managers because of the potential damaging effects on recreational facilities and aquatic habitat. The purpose of this study is to develop a geographic information systems (GIS)/remote sensing (RS) based methodology to monitor spatial patterns of gravel deposition and lateral channel migration within …
Methods For Correcting Topographically Induced Radiometric Distortion On Landsat Thematic Mapper Images For Land Cover Classification, David Michael Rosen
Methods For Correcting Topographically Induced Radiometric Distortion On Landsat Thematic Mapper Images For Land Cover Classification, David Michael Rosen
Geography Masters Research Papers
Satellite imagery is commonly used to study land-use, land-cover change in mountainous areas. Classification of land-cover types is particularly difficult in this type of terrain because topography affects the spectral response of surface features. Several techniques have been developed to help compensate for this topographic effect and to increase classification accuracy.
The purpose of this study is to compare topographic correction methods to determine which produces the most accurate results. Method 1 does not use any topographic correction, serving as a control. Method 2 is based on the Lambertian model, and uses topographical data as variables in an equation. Method …
Monitoring Spatial And Temporal Water Quality Changes In Iowa Lakes Using Airborne Hyperspectral Imagery, Nathan Robert Green
Monitoring Spatial And Temporal Water Quality Changes In Iowa Lakes Using Airborne Hyperspectral Imagery, Nathan Robert Green
Dissertations and Theses @ UNI
The U.S. Environmental Protection Agency (US EPA) has identified more than 20,000 water bodies across America as polluted mainly due to agricultural non-point source pollution. Current techniques for monitoring and assessing the quality of waters in streams, reservoirs, lakes, and estuaries involve on site measurements and/or the collection of water samples for subsequent laboratory analyses. While this approach yields accurate measurements for a point in time and space, it is expensive, laborious, and cannot provide a temporal or spatial overview of water-quality trends. To overcome this liability, state and local agencies are seeking alternative and more cost effective methods. A …
